Transaction 8ae950781b39632727e0e4982d9c62eb0201a1e8d1c2fe33ab86866e67be0ccb
1 Input
1 Output
-
8ae950781b39632727e0e4982d9c62eb0201a1e8d1c2fe33ab86866e67be0ccb:0
- value
- 123124
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76010d9cbb232592b0b9d0804f0e41ad83aa79ea OP_EQUAL
- address
- 3CSxvMa4EsnFzNZY5WSVG223McVzxGyxrh